Aspose.Words.MailMerging

TheAspose.Words.MailMerging Пространство имен содержит классы «оригинального» движка отчетов по слиянию почты the .

Классы

Учебный классОписание
FieldMergingArgsПредоставляет данные дляMergeField событие.
FieldMergingArgsBaseБазовый класс дляFieldMergingArgs иImageFieldMergingArgs .
ImageFieldMergingArgsПредоставляет данные дляImageFieldMerging событие.
MailMergeПредставляет функциональность слияния почты.
MailMergeRegionInfoСодержит информацию о регионе слияния почты.
MappedDataFieldCollectionПозволяет автоматически сопоставлять имена полей в источнике данных и имена полей слияния в документе.
MustacheTagПредставляет тег «усы».

Интерфейсы

ИнтерфейсОписание
IFieldMergingCallbackРеализуйте этот интерфейс, если вы хотите контролировать, как данные вставляются в поля слияния во время операции слияния почты.
IMailMergeCallbackРеализуйте этот интерфейс, если вы хотите получать уведомления во время выполнения слияния почты.
IMailMergeDataSourceРеализуйте этот интерфейс, чтобы разрешить слияние почты из пользовательского источника данных, например, списка объектов. Также поддерживаются данные Master-detail.
IMailMergeDataSourceRootРеализуйте этот интерфейс, чтобы разрешить слияние почты из пользовательского источника данных с данными master-detail.

перечисление

перечислениеОписание
MailMergeCleanupOptionsУказывает параметры, определяющие, какие элементы удаляются во время слияния почты.